attention sink
**Attention sink** is the **phenomenon where certain tokens attract disproportionate attention mass, reducing effective use of other context tokens** - it can degrade long-context quality when not managed in prompt and model design.
**What Is Attention sink?**
- **Definition**: A token-level imbalance in attention allocation where a few positions dominate attention flow.
- **Typical Triggers**: Can arise from special tokens, repetitive prefixes, or positional effects in long prompts.
- **Observed Impact**: Important evidence may be under-attended when sink tokens absorb model focus.
- **Analytical Role**: Used as a diagnostic concept in long-context behavior evaluation.
